What Makes Pink Watercolor Heart PNG Clipart Unique

At its core, this clipart is a digital illustration of a heart shape rendered in a watercolor style, with varying pink tones that create depth and a handmade feel. The PNG format means the background is transparent, so you can place the heart onto any color or image without dealing with white boxes or awkward edges. The watercolor effect gives it a soft, organic look—think of the gentle bleed of pigment on wet paper, with subtle variations in opacity and brush texture. This is not a flat, vector-style heart. It has dimension, soft edges, and an artistic quality that feels more personal than a standard icon.

The personality of this clipart leans romantic, gentle, and approachable. It is the kind of asset that works beautifully for projects that need a touch of warmth or emotion without feeling overly polished or corporate. The pink palette ranges from pale blush to deeper rose, which gives it flexibility across different brand color schemes. Because it is a raster image with watercolor texture, it also carries a tactile quality that resonates well in digital spaces where users crave authenticity and human connection.

Practical Guidance for Choosing and Using Pink Watercolor Heart PNG Clipart

Before you download and start using this clipart, there are a few considerations that can make a real difference in your final results. Here is what to look for and how to get the most out of the asset.

Evaluate Resolution and File Quality

Not all PNG clipart is created equal. Check the resolution of the Pink Watercolor Heart PNG Clipart before using it in print projects. A low-resolution file that looks fine on screen may appear pixelated when printed at a larger size. Look for files that are at least 300 DPI for print use, and confirm that the transparent background is clean without rough edges or leftover pixels. If you plan to scale the heart up significantly, you may need a larger file size or a vector alternative.

Consider Your Brand Color Palette

The pink tones in this clipart come in various shades, so make sure the specific version you choose complements your existing brand colors. A pale blush heart works beautifully with white, cream, gray, or soft blue. A deeper rose heart pairs well with warm neutrals, gold, or dark green. If you are using the clipart across multiple materials, consistency matters. Try to use the same shade of pink throughout your project to maintain a cohesive brand identity.

Test Font Pairings and Layout Combinations

When you place text over or near the Pink Watercolor Heart PNG Clipart, the typeface you choose matters. Because the heart has a soft, artistic texture, it pairs well with handwritten script fonts, modern serifs, and clean sans serif fonts. Avoid combining it with heavy, blocky typefaces that feel industrial, as the contrast can feel jarring. A simple rule: let the clipart set the emotional tone, and choose a font that supports that same mood. For example, a delicate script font on top of the heart works well for a wedding invitation, while a bold sans serif placed next to the heart creates a modern, confident look for a brand logo.

Review Licensing and Usage Rights

This is an often overlooked but critical step. Commercial use of the Pink Watercolor Heart PNG Clipart may require a specific license, especially if you plan to use it in products you sell, such as printed merchandise, digital templates, or logo designs. Some clipart comes with a standard license that covers personal and small business use, while other versions require an extended license for broader commercial application. Always read the terms from the source where you download or purchase the asset. This protects you from legal issues and ensures you are using the design ethically.

Think About Consistency Across Your Design Assets

If you are building a brand identity, using one watercolor heart in isolation may feel disconnected from your other visuals. Consider how this clipart fits within your broader set of design assets. Does it match the texture, style, and color palette of your other graphics? If you use multiple watercolor elements, ensure they share a similar brush style and paper texture so the overall look feels intentional. Consistency builds professionalism and recognition over time.
